Resonating Forest in the Springs(old:Resonating Forest in the Ravine)

teamLab, 2019-, from the series Resonating Trees, 2014-, Interactive Installation, Endless, Sound: Hideaki Takahashi

The water from this spring forms the pond of Mifuneyama Rakuen.


When people or animals pass close to the trees, the trees shine brightly and produce a tone. That light and tone then spreads out continuously, one by one, to the surrounding trees.

If a wave of light comes from afar, it signifies the presence of people or animals there. Perhaps, people gain a heightened sense of awareness of the existence of other people or animals in the same space and the environment.

5 teamLab astounding projects from 2019

teamLab is a Japan-based studio seeking to merge art and technology as well as explore the relationship between humans and nature.
Combining the efforts from various individuals and fields of knowledge, from artists, designers, engineers, programmers, architects, and mathematicians, teamLab explores the relationship between humans and nature. (Excerpt from the text)
